如何从 Android 设备中安全地提取系统密钥91
引言
系统密钥对于保护 Android 设备免受未经授权的访问至关重要。它们用于加密数据、验证应用程序和执行其他安全操作。由于其敏感性,系统密钥受到多层安全措施的保护。然而,在某些情况下,可能需要从设备中提取这些密钥,例如进行法医调查或恢复丢失的数据。
获取系统密钥的风险
在考虑从 Android 设备中提取系统密钥之前,了解潜在风险非常重要。如果密钥落入错误之手,它可能会被用于以下目的:
解密设备上的数据并访问敏感信息
绕过安全措施并安装恶意应用程序
冒充合法用户并进行欺诈交易
从锁定设备中提取密钥
从已锁定的 Android 设备中提取系统密钥通常非常困难,因为密钥存储在安全加密区域中。然而,有一些专业技巧可以绕过这些安全措施。例如,使用物理攻击技术,如JTAG,可以访问设备的内部存储并提取密钥。
从解锁设备中提取密钥
从已解锁的 Android 设备中提取系统密钥更加容易。可以使用以下方法之一:* 利用 root 访问权限: root 访问权限允许用户访问设备的文件系统和系统设置。可以利用此访问权限来提取系统密钥。
* 使用调试工具: Android 调试桥 (ADB) 和 fastboot 等工具允许用户通过 USB 连接与设备进行交互。这些工具可以用来提取系统密钥。
安全提取密钥的步骤
为了安全地从 Android 设备中提取系统密钥,请遵循以下步骤:1. 确保设备已解锁:密钥只能从已解锁的设备中提取。
2. 安装必需的工具:安装 ADB、fastboot 和任何其他必要的工具。
3. 启用 USB 调试:在设备的“开发者选项”中启用 USB 调试。
4. 连接设备:使用 USB 数据线将设备连接到计算机。
5. 提取密钥:使用 ADB 或 fastboot 命令提取密钥。
6. 安全存储密钥:将提取的密钥安全地存储在加密容器中。
结论
从 Android 设备中提取系统密钥是一项复杂的任务,需要高度专业知识。虽然从已解锁的设备中提取密钥相对容易,但从已锁定的设备中提取密钥却非常困难。无论哪种情况下,在执行此操作之前,了解潜在风险并采取适当的预防措施非常重要。始终确保安全地存储提取的密钥,并仅在必要时使用它们。
2025-01-11
新文章

Linux引导过程详解及常见问题排查

Android系统测试描述撰写指南:涵盖方法、用例及报告

深入探讨Linux内核:架构、设计与实现

Linux系统nohup命令失效原因及排查方法

Linux系统安全退出及相关指令详解

在VirtualBox中安装和配置Linux虚拟机:操作系统原理与实践指南

Linux新手:选择适合你的发行版指南

Linux系统日志分析与常见错误排查

Android系统演进:架构、功能及未来发展方向

鸿蒙操作系统:架构、特性及与其他操作系统的比较
热门文章

iOS 系统的局限性

Linux USB 设备文件系统

Mac OS 9:革命性操作系统的深度剖析

华为鸿蒙操作系统:业界领先的分布式操作系统

**三星 One UI 与华为 HarmonyOS 操作系统:详尽对比**

macOS 直接安装新系统,保留原有数据

Windows系统精简指南:优化性能和提高效率
![macOS 系统语言更改指南 [专家详解]](https://cdn.shapao.cn/1/1/f6cabc75abf1ff05.png)
macOS 系统语言更改指南 [专家详解]

iOS 操作系统:移动领域的先驱
